July Dinner Club Recap

I know you are all "ears" to hear about our corny dinner this month!

The evening started with a trip down memory lane...Grapes was cleaning out her photo collection, and came across this gem from her bachelorette party 10 years ago!  Now that'scorn-fed boy!

We had a field day at Couscous' crib, with her fun summer dishes.

Grapes got the evening off to a tasty start with peppers (jalopeno and sweet reds) stuffed with cornbread  and wrapped with bacon (or unwrapped for the vegetarians!)

And a bottle of  Dialed In red wine, because the label looked like the end of a corn cob??   You be the judge.



 Couscous' culinary contribution consisted of buttercrust corn pie with fresh tomato salsa. A saltine cracker crust that was scrumptious!


Paprika created her own side dish by combining three different recipes for a delicious rice salad with black beans, corn (roasted over an open camp fire!), peppers and a vinaigrette.











Her wine contribution was a refreshing sauvignon blanc from Nobilo.


No one had a batch of corn based wine ready, but there was talk of heading down to West Virginia to sample some Apple Pie Moonshine!














Saucy completed our corn fest with a spice cake made with creamed corn and a caramel icing.  Amaizeing! and she served it in theme appropriate dishes - Corn Cob plates!!
